Armand Auger

Of Tewksbury, formerly of Everett

Armand V. Auger of Tewksbury, formerly of Everett, died on August 21. He was 96 years old.

In 1944, Mr. Auger founded the Auger Heating Company of Malden and Everett, which he operated for more than 40 years. In the early 1980’s, he founded the Auger Realty Company of Revere.

He was the son of the late Louis and Marianne (Lavallee) Auger; beloved husband of 70 years to Marie-Jeanne (Petrilli) Auger; devoted father of John P. of Hollis, ME, Richard and his wife, Laurie, of Boxford, Roger and his wife, Linnie, of Billerica, Donald and his wife, Debbie, of Tewksbury, Diane Kelley and her husband, John, of Tewksbury and the late Claire Devanna; brother of Pauline Savage and Therese Descoteau, both of Worcester and the late Leo, Bernadette and Connie Auger, and Isabelle Morin. He leaves 15 grandchildren, nine great grandchildren and many nieces and nephews.

Edward Buchanan

Truck Driver

Edward Buchanan of Everett, formerly of Saugus, died unexpectedly on August 14 in Maine. He was 54 years old.

Born in Malden, the son of the late Charles and Elizabeth (Konczal) Buchanan, he was raised and educated in Saugus and was graduate of Saugus High School, class of 1973. He worked as a truck driver for Caruso Trucking in Revere for more than 30 years. He enjoyed biking, cooking and was a lover of animals, especially dogs.

He is survived by his loving fiancé, Lois Guido, of Everett, his brother Jack “Cuzzin” Buchanan of North Waterboro, Maine, and by many dear friends in Maine and Massachusetts.

Frank Johnson

Middlesex County Sheriff’s Department retiree

Frank E. Johnson died on August 15 after a long illness at The Newton Wellesley Hospital. He was 70 years old.

Born in Cambridge, he grew up in Everett and attended the Everett Schools.  He lived in Medford for the past 45 years and retired eight years ago from the Middlesex County Sheriff’s Department.

He was the loving husband of Olga C. (Dandaneau) Johnson and cherished father of Frank E. Jr. and his wife, Sheri Elliott-Johnson, of California, Lisa Hinton, Michael and his wife, Tracy Johnson, Olga and her husband, Michael Correia, and Kathleen Johnson, all of Medford; brother of Patricia and her husband, Joseph Fialli, of Everett, and the late Fred Johnson Jr. He was the grandfather of Nicole, Scott, Tori, Jade, Kira, and Max.
